Performance & Speed

  • % of visitors who abandon after 3s page load: ~32%.

  • Ideal TTFB (time to first byte) target: <200 ms.

  • Recommended Largest Contentful Paint (LCP): <2.5 s.

  • Recommended First Input Delay (FID) or Interaction to Next Paint: <100 ms.

  • Average page weight (desktop): ~1.5–3 MB.

  • Average page weight (mobile): ~1–2.5 MB.

  • Image optimization reduces page size by: 30–70% on average.

  • Enabling compression (gzip/br) reduces text payloads by ~60–80%.

  • CDN adoption among medium+ sites: ~65–85%.

  • Percentage of pages with render-blocking scripts unoptimized: ~40–60%.
